lisp/ox-icalendar.el: Add time-to-live functionality to ox-icalendar
This commit adds functionality for ox-icalendar to set X-PUBLISHED-TTL in the exported ICS, which advises a subscriber to the exported ICS file to reload after the given time interval. * lisp/ox-icalendar.el (org-icalendar-ttl): New option to set X-PUBLISHED-TTL in exported ICS (icalendar): Add ICAL-TTL export keyword (org-icalendar--vcalendar): Add argument for TTL (org-icalendar-template, org-icalendar-export-current-agenda, org-icalendar--combine-files): Pass TTL to `org-icalendar--vcalendar' Co-authored-by: Ihor Radchenko <yantar92@posteo.net> Co-authored-by: Jack Kamm <jackkamm@gmail.com>

** New and changed options
|
||||
*** New custom setting ~org-icalendar-ttl~ for the ~ox-icalendar~ backend
|
||||
|
||||
The option ~org-icalendar-ttl~ allows to advise a subscriber to the
|
||||
exported =.ics= file to reload after the given time interval.
|
||||
|
||||
This is useful i.e. if a calendar server subscribes to your exported
|
||||
file and that file is updated regularly.
|
||||
|
||||
See IETF RFC 5545, Section 3.3.6 Duration and
|
||||
https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/ICalendar#Other_component_types for
|
||||
details.
|
||||
|
||||
Default for ~org-icalendar-ttl~ is ~nil~. In that case the setting
|
||||
will not be used in the exported ICS file.
|
||||
|
||||
The option may also be set using the =ICAL-TTL= keyword.

(defcustom org-icalendar-ttl nil
|
||||
"Time to live for the exported calendar.
|
||||
|
||||
Subscribing clients to the exported ics file can derive the time
|
||||
interval to read the file again from the server. One example of such
|
||||
client is Nextcloud calendar, which respects the setting of
|
||||
X-PUBLISHED-TTL in ICS files. Setting `org-icalendar-ttl' to \"PT1H\"
|
||||
would advise a server to reload the file every hour.
|
||||
|
||||
See https://icalendar.org/iCalendar-RFC-5545/3-8-2-5-duration.html
|
||||
for a complete description of possible specifications of this
|
||||
option. For example, \"PT1H\" stands for 1 hour and
|
||||
\"PT0H27M34S\" stands for 0 hours, 27 minutes and 34 seconds.
|
||||
|
||||
The default value is nil, which means no such option is set in
|
||||
the ICS file. This option can also be set on a per-document basis
|
||||
with the ICAL-TTL export keyword."
|
||||
:group 'org-export-icalendar
|
||||
:type '(choice
|
||||
(const :tag "No refresh period" nil)
|
||||
(const :tag "One hour" "PT1H")
|
||||
(const :tag "One day" "PT1D")
|
||||
(const :tag "One week" "PT7D")
|
||||
(string :tag "Other"))
|
||||
:package-version '(Org . "9.7"))
